Golem Overview and Statistics

The Golem is a fearsome unit that boasts incredible health and damage stats. This colossal creature is unlocked at Town Hall level 8 and can be upgraded to level 8 in the Laboratory.

The Golem has a staggering 7,000 hit points at max level and deals 38 damage per second. Its massive size and high hit points make it an excellent tank unit, capable of soaking up damage while other troops wreak havoc on the enemy base.

Additionally, the Golem has a unique death effect – upon its demise, it splits into two smaller Golemites, each with reduced hit points but still capable of dealing damage.

This ability can be a game-changer in the right circumstances.

When deploying the Golem, it’s important to consider its relatively slow movement speed. This means planning your attack carefully and ensuring other troops support the Golem well is crucial. A lone Golem can be easily overwhelmed by defenses, so creating a balanced army composition that complements the Golem’s strengths is essential.

Golem Strengths and Weaknesses

Like any troop in Clash of Clans, the Golem has its own set of strengths and weaknesses. Understanding these can help you make the most out of this formidable unit and avoid costly mistakes during battles.

One of the Golem’s primary strengths is its exceptional tanking ability. With its massive hit points, the Golem can draw the attention of defenses, allowing other troops to deal damage without being targeted. This makes it an ideal unit to deploy at the frontlines, creating a shield for your more fragile troops.

Additionally, the Golem’s ability to split into Golemites upon death can catch opponents off guard and provide an extra layer of distraction.

However, the Golem also has its weaknesses. Its slow movement speed makes it vulnerable to attacks from long-range defenses such as the X-Bow or Inferno Tower. These defenses can quickly chip away at the Golem’s health, leaving it ineffective and wasting valuable housing space.

Additionally, the Golem’s high housing space of 30 means that you’ll need to carefully consider your army composition to ensure you have enough space for other essential troops.

Golem Attack Strategies

Now that we’ve covered the basics of the Golem, let’s dive into some attack strategies that can help you make the most out of this powerful unit. The Golem pairs well with a variety of other troops and spells, each offering unique advantages and tactics.

One popular strategy is the “Golem-Wizard” strategy. This involves deploying a Golem to soak up damage while Wizards follow close behind, dealing massive damage to defenses and clearing a path for your other troops.

The Golem acts as a shield, protecting the fragile Wizards and allowing them to wreak havoc on the enemy base. This strategy is particularly effective against bases with clustered defenses, as the Wizards can quickly eliminate them with their splash damage.

Another effective strategy is the “Golem-P.E.K.K.A.” combo. This powerful duo combines the tanking ability of the Golem with the devastating damage output of the P.E.K.K.A. The Golem distracts, drawing the attention of defenses, while the P.E.K.K.A. deals massive damage and destroys key structures. This strategy is ideal for taking down heavily fortified bases and can quickly turn the tide of battle in your favor.

Golem Synergies with Other Troops and Spells

To truly maximize the effectiveness of the Golem, it’s essential to pair it with other troops and spells that complement its strengths. Combining the Golem with the right troops and spells can create devastating attacks that can decimate even the most fortified bases.

One effective synergy is the combination of the Golem, Wizards, and heal spells. The Golem serves as a tank, drawing the attention of defenses, while the Wizards deal massive damage.

The heal spells can then be used to keep the Golem and other troops alive, allowing them to sustain the assault and destroy the enemy base. This strategy is particularly effective against bases with high-level defenses and can quickly turn the tide of battle in your favor.

Another powerful synergy is the combination of the Golem, Bowlers, and rage spells. Bowlers are excellent at dealing splash damage, making them ideal for clearing out clusters of defenses. The Golem acts as a tank, protecting the Bowlers and allowing them to deal maximum damage.

The rage spells can then be used to boost the Bowlers’ attack speed and damage output, making them even deadlier. This strategy is particularly effective against bases with compact defenses.

Tips and Tricks for Using Golem Effectively

Here are some additional tips and tricks that can help you make the most out of the Golem and elevate your gameplay to the next level:

  1. Use wall breakers or jump spells to create a path for the Golem. This ensures that it reaches the core of the enemy base, where it can cause maximum damage.
  2. Deploy supporting troops behind the Golem to ensure they stay protected. Troops like Wizards, Bowlers, or even Valkyries can deal massive damage when protected by the Golem.
  3. Utilize freeze spells to temporarily disable defenses, allowing your Golem and other troops to deal damage without being targeted.
  4. Consider the positioning of your Golem when deploying it. Placing it near high-value targets like the enemy’s Town Hall or Clan Castle can help draw the attention of defenses and distract them from your other troops.
  5. Experiment with different troop compositions and attack strategies to find the one that works best for your playstyle. The Golem is a versatile unit that can be paired with various troops and spells, so don’t be afraid to try new combinations.
